In the above study, the investigators determined that a low concentration of DNP increased the average life span from 719 days (

Control) to 770 days (DNP). If the U.S. population has an average life span of 79 years, then how many years would be added if the same percentage increase were observed?
Express your answer using two significant figures.

Answer:

Increase in average life span of U.S. in terms of years is 5.6\\ years

Explanation:

The controlled  average life span is 719\\ days

The DNP  average life span is 770\\ days

Increase in the average life span is

770 - 719\\= 51\\ days

Rate of increase of average life span after using DNP

(Change in life span in day /\\ Base average life span) * 100\\

= \frac{51}{719} * 100\\= 7.09\\ %

It is given that the average life span of US people will also increase by the same rate, then the new average life span would be

Base average life span +\\ Increase in average life span

= 79 + ((\frac{7.09}{100} ) * 79)\\= 84.60\\

So the increase in average life span of U.S. in terms of years is 5.6\\ years

A student performed an experiment with bags of dialysis tubing filled with distilled water to model the process of osmosis. Dial
Reil [10]

Answer:

Taking into account the principle of osmosis, the question that best addresses experimental design is  <em>How does the effect of environmental sucrose concentrations impact the  movement of water across a membrane?</em>

Explanation:

The experimental design of the student, made with dialysis bags and sucrose at different concentrations should recreate the principle of osmosis, of importance in living beings for organic homeostasis.

Osmosis consists of the movement of water - through a semi-permeable membrane - from a less concentrated solution to a higher concentration solution, following a gradient, to achieve balance.  

The student will observe in his experiment that water moves from the solution with less sucrose concentration to the higher concentration of sugar. Beakers with the highest concentration of sucrose will have the highest weight, due to the increase in liquid volume.

How does the effect of environmental sucrose concentrations impact the  movement of water across a membrane?

The experiment shows that:

  1. The water from the beaker with less sucrose concentration moved -through the dialysis tubes and the membrane- to the beaker containing the most concentrated sucrose.
  2. Different sucrose concentrations will attract different amounts of water, which influences the final weight of each container.

With this experiment the principle of osmosis is confirmed, where the concentration of a solute determines the amount of water that passes through a semipermeable membrane -following a concentration gradient- until equilibrium is reached.
